Abstract:
一种圆柱阵列形跨尺度葡萄糖传感器用工作电极及其制备方法。将普通多模光纤包层剥去并抽出光纤纤芯,基于磁控溅射工艺将Au膜沉积在光纤纤芯表面;将多根沉积有Au膜的光纤纤芯在玻璃基板上紧密排列,并用银粉导电胶将其固定,形成具有微米级圆柱阵列形结构的电极基底;基于水浴法在沉积有Au膜的光纤纤芯阵列上生长ZnO纳米线,形成圆柱阵列形跨尺度结构的纳米级表面,用来增大GOD的吸附面积,从而大幅度提高基于三电极体系的跨尺度葡萄糖传感器用工作电极的催化效率。
